How dog memory works: an overview
Dogs remember things, but in ways that suit their social, scent-driven lives rather than human-style recall of specific episodes. Canine memory is shaped by association, routine, and strong sensory cues, allowing them to learn consistent behaviors while forgetting details that don’t matter for survival. Understanding what dogs remember and how they forget helps owners train more effectively, enrich daily life, and set realistic expectations. This guide explains short-term and long-term memory, what dogs remember most, and practical ways to support their learning.
Short-term versus long-term memory in dogs
Short-term or working memory
Dogs hold brief impressions of events and cues for roughly seconds to a few minutes. This working memory supports immediate tasks like following a hand signal for a sit or waiting through a short door threshold routine. It fades quickly when attention shifts, unless the experience is emotionally charged or repeatedly practiced. For most routine training, short-term memory means a dog needs consistent, brief repetitions to form reliable habits.
Long-term memory and associative learning
Long-term memory lets dogs retain skills, routines, and emotionally significant experiences over months or years. They remember people, places, and patterns through associations between cues, outcomes, and feelings. A dog may recall that a leash means a walk, a particular bag means a trip to the vet, or that a specific command leads to a reward. Emotional events, whether positive or negative, often persist the longest because they influence future choices and reactions.
What dogs remember most reliably
Dogs excel at certain types of memory and struggle with others. They are strong at remembering routines, locations linked to rewards or danger, and individuals connected to social bonds or strong experiences. They are weaker at remembering exact sequences of events or details that lack clear relevance to their needs. Recognizing these strengths helps owners set practical training goals and reduce frustration when a dog forgets a cue that seemed obvious to them.
Key types of memory in dogs
| Memory type | What dogs remember | Time frame |
|---|---|---|
| Short-term / working | Cues, actions, and tasks needed now | Seconds to minutes |
| Long-term associative | People, places, routines tied to outcomes | Months to years |
| Emotional | Feelings linked to experiences | Long-lasting, especially for strong events |
| Scent and procedural | Smells and learned behaviors | Highly durable when practiced |
How scent, emotion, and routine shape memory
Scent is a primary channel for canine memory, because dogs process smells in ways humans cannot. A familiar odor can trigger recognition and location memories even when visual cues are weak. Emotional experiences, whether pleasant or stressful, sharpen retention and influence future behavior. Consistent routines help dogs form stable expectations; repeated patterns become procedural memories that require less conscious thought and make everyday interactions smoother.
Supporting memory with training and enrichment
You can support a dog’s memory through clear, consistent cues, short frequent training sessions, and meaningful rewards that strengthen associations. Enrichment that engages the senses, such as sniffing games, foraging, and safe exploratory walks, gives dogs mentally stimulating patterns to remember. Predictable routines for meals, play, and rest reduce anxiety and help dogs learn household expectations, making it easier for them to remember desired behaviors across different contexts.
When memory concerns arise
Occasional forgetfulness is normal and often reflects distractions, poor communication, or low motivation rather than a memory deficit. Persistent confusion, failure to recognize familiar people or places, or sudden changes in house training may indicate medical issues such as cognitive decline or neurological problems and warrant a veterinary visit. Early attention to pain, hearing, or vision issues can preserve both comfort and memory-related behaviors in aging dogs.
